Abstract:
A system may include a memory storing a turbomachinery degradation model configured to model degradation of a turbine system over time. Further, the system may include a controller communicatively coupled to the memory, which derives a turbomachinery wash timing based on at least one input signal from the turbine system and the turbomachinery degradation model. The turbomachinery degradation model may derive a desired wash point by estimating a modeled power of the turbine system, a modeled heat rate of the turbine system, or both. Furthermore, the controller may use the desired wash point to determine a time for washing components of the turbine system.
